About Us
Gaia-liNc e.V. is a German-based organization formed by Latin-American and European members committed to the sustainable development of Central and South America’s communities and their territories.
Our History
Gaia-liNc was founded by several students at the Technical University of Munich (TUM). While pursuing a M.Sc. in Sustainable Resource Management, our members found a common interest of initiating, developing, implementing, and supporting cooperation projects between Europe and Latin-America, and founded gaia-liNc e.V. as an NGO committed to the sustainable development of Latin America’s communities and their territories.
Gaia-liNc is a german-based organization formed by Latin-American and European members. We are based in Munich, Germany with members located in several different cities around the globe.

Frequently Asked Questions
the founding of the gaia-liNc organization came together in August 2019 with eight students at the Technical University of Munich, Germany (TUM). gaia-liNc was officially registrared as a German NGO (gaia-liNc e.V.)in the spring of 2020.
gaia-liNc e.V. initiates, develops, implements and supports development cooperation projects that support the bridge between Latin America and Europe in contexts of mitigation, adaptation, cultural/education, and transdisciplinary and cross sectoral issues.
As we have listed above, gaia-liNc is open to different collaborations, partnerships and projects that fit into our interests of bettering relationships between Latin America and Europe for development projects.
The concept of gaia-liNc came about between a group of students from Latin America who were studying sustainable resources management in Munich, Germany. The course inspired them to think of ways of further collaboration between Germany and Latin America for development projects, and the idea of gaia-liNc came about to stand as a bridge between the two continents.
